The Habeas Corpus example in sentence in Middlesex is a legal form filed by a petitioner who is currently in state custody, challenging the legality of their imprisonment. This petition outlines the petitioner's personal information, the respondents involved, and the grounds for relief, including claims of ineffective assistance of counsel and lack of mental competency at the time of the guilty plea. The form requires completion of various fields such as the petitioner's name, prison details, and legal representation, alongside a detailed account of the petitioner’s mental health issues and their impact on their legal proceedings. Key features include sections that allow for the inclusion of supporting exhibits and affidavits to reinforce the claims made in the petition. The form is vital for those seeking to pursue a legal remedy for perceived injustices in their convictions, particularly for individuals with mental health challenges who require appropriate care rather than correctional confinement. A writ of habeas corpus orders the custodian of an individual in custody to produce the individual before the court to make an inquiry concerning his or her detention, to appear for prosecution (ad prosequendum) or to appear to testify (ad testificandum).

Typical examples where a court has granted a habeas corpus petition include claims of new evidence discovered in the case, ineffective assistance of counsel, prosecutorial misconduct, incompetence to stand trial, and challenging conditions of confinement.

Thus, to effectively file a writ of habeas corpus in California state court, an inmate must have been convicted and either serving a sentence of incarceration, probation or parole. They must have also filed a direct appeal to the appellate court and then to the California Supreme Court.
